A field investigation was conducted at Instructional farm of Krishi Vigyan Kendra Kendrapara, Odisha during kharif and rabi seasons of 2013-14 and 2014-15 in ricegroundnut cropping system under irrigated medium land situation. The soil of the experimental site was sandy loam in texture with pH of 5.7, organic carbon of 0.52 % having available soil nitrogen, phosphorus and potassium of 390.9 kg/ha, 10.1 kg/ha and 190.1 kg/ha respectively.

Groundnuts in India are available throughout the year due to a two crop cycle which are harvested in March and October. Rajasthan is the second highest groundnut producing state in India. In 2018-19, groundnut was cultivated on 0.67 million hectares area in the state, producing to a level of 1.38 million tonnes.

An analytical study was made to identify the efficient cropping zone for groundnut in Tamil Nadu. For this study the data on percentage area and productivity of groundnut for ten years (2006-07 to 2015-16) were collected. Based on relative spread index (RSI) and relative yield index (RYI) the efficient cropping zone were identified. Among thirty one districts, five districts were found as most efficient cropping zones (MECZ).

In Maharashtra total area under kharif groundnut crop during 2019 is 187500 ha and total production is 193827 tones along with productivity 1034 kg / ha. In Maharashtra Groundnut is important oilseed crop which is cultivated in all season. In Maharashtra mostly groundnut varieties used for cultivation are TAG-24, Phule Vyas, Phule Pragati, TG-26, JKG-194, AK-159, SB-11. (Sources: www. iopepc.org.).

The field experiment on screening of tomato lines for GBNV infection was carried out Horticultural College and Research Institute, Tamil Nadu Agricultural University and Coimbatore. Totally 25 hybrids/varieties were screened in Rabi season during 2015. None of the varieties/hybrids screened were resistant or immune to GBNV during Rabi season. However, average disease incidence ranged from 7.55 to 25.25 percent indicating moderately resistant to highly susceptible.

Sunflower (Helianthus annuus L.) is an important edible oilseed crop in the country next to groundnut and soybean. One of the major factors for reduction in area of the crop is being attributed to the occurrence of fungal and viral diseases like sunflower necrosis disease (SND) and Sunflower leaf curl virus (SuLCV) resulting in yield loss in most of the sunflower growing regions of Southern and Northern India. In Karnataka, SuLCV has been reported to occur in almost all the popular sunflower hybrids grown during kharif, rabi and summer seasons with varied intensity.

A survey was conducted in major groundnut growing areas of different tehsil of Jodhpur district, Rajasthan during kharif 2019 to assess the distribution and the incidence of collar rot diseases. The highest incidences of collar rot were observed in Phalodi (15.31 %).Whereas, least collar rot incidence was observed (10.0%) in Tewari. The overall average disease incidence of the Jodhpur district was (12.43%) based on 125 fields surveyed in cropping season 2019.
